The Peacock series 'Angelyne' is based on the eponymous billboard queen who became a Los Angeles icon in the '80s. The artist came to prominence in 1984 after the appearance of a series of catchy billboards in and around Los Angeles, California that simply read "Angelyne" and pictured her posing suggestively. 

The show revolves around her life and her choices, disappointments, and betrayals. It dives deep into the icon’s life and gives viewers an idea of how she presented herself to everyone and made a luxurious life for herself.

The series starts with the actress whispering to herself, "I am not a woman, I am an icon." Throughout her life, she's got into gigs and involved herself with people to make use of any opportunity that knocked on her door claiming it would give her the fame and name she wanted. The story begins with her befriending a boy from the Blue Band. While he madly falls in love with her, she's just here for business. She knows what she wants and uses him to get to the top.

She starts to get famous by putting up billboards of her in every place possible in Los Angeles. This gets her noticed, just as she wanted. As the story progresses, her need for control over her self-perception only grows stronger. We see several men get sucked into her, only to be spit out eventually.

Some may find a fan moment or two in the proceedings while others may not exactly take to how she uses people who genuinely care about her. The ending, though, does give some insight into where Angelyne came from, and perhaps even explains why she did what she did, and the way she did it. It throws light on her abysmal childhood and shows us what her first love was like. The actress has a troubled relationship with her controlling father, and the situation only gets worse after her mother passes away, when she is barely 14.

Nothing comes easy for her as she can't talk to her parents about her feelings. The only company she has is her little sister. One night, her boyfriend takes her back to her house to apologize for not being there enough when she needed him. Though she asks him to get out from there, he insists and keeps talking. That night becomes quite the turning point for her and she realizes she could be so much more than she is.

The story then jumps back to the original plot where the adult Angelyne is bombarded with a dozen phone calls on the latest news report about her. All of a sudden, she is a people's favorite. Her billboards keep going up, and she is now a sensation.
